Exploring Insight Learning in Animals: Key Examples and Scientific Insights
Insight learning is a pretty intriguing topic in the animal world. Imagine a situation where an animal suddenly figures something out to solve a problem, like it’s an unexpected *lightbulb moment*. This type of learning is different from just trial and error. Instead, it’s almost like they’re brainstorming in their heads before acting.
When we talk about insight learning, we can’t overlook the famous experiments with chimpanzees. One classic study involves a chimp named Sultan who faced a frustrating challenge. He needed to reach a banana that was hanging out of his reach. After pondering for a bit, he grabbed two sticks lying nearby, combined them to create a longer stick, and then snagged the banana! Talk about cleverness! This showed not just problem-solving but also some understanding of how objects interact.
Another example comes from our feathery friends—the crows. Research has highlighted crows making tools to retrieve food, which is seriously impressive. In one experiment, they bent wires into hooks to fish out food from tight spots. They didn’t just do this by accident but seemed to plan and understand what was necessary!
Now, insight learning isn’t limited to these two cases. Dogs and rats have also displayed this kind of smarts. Like when you train your pup with a puzzle box that hides treats inside—some dogs can figure it out on their own when they see it done once or twice! And for rats? They’ve shown dramatic problem-solving abilities too, using what they know about their environment creatively.
Researchers have dug deep into understanding why this happens. Many studies suggest that animals with larger brains relative to their body size tend to show more insight learning abilities. It seems that having more neural connections gives them an edge when processing information and coming up with solutions.

Exploring Scientific Research on Animals: Methods, Ethics, and Impact in the Field of Science
Exploring scientific research on animals is a fascinating journey, intertwining methods, ethics, and real impacts in the field of science. There’s so much to understand about how we study animals and what that means for them—and us!
Methods are pretty varied when it comes to studying animal learning. Scientists often use observation techniques in their natural habitats. Imagine watching a group of dolphins working together to catch fish—it shows not just learning but also social interaction! Another method involves controlled experiments where researchers might train an animal using rewards, like treats, to see how they learn tasks. For instance, lab rats are often used in maze experiments to examine problem-solving skills. It’s all about discovering how they react to different stimuli.
But there’s another layer to this—ethics. This is super important because it deals with the well-being of the animals involved in research. Researchers must ensure that their studies don’t cause harm or undue stress to the animals. A well-known example is the “3Rs” principle: replacement, reduction, and refinement. Basically, it encourages scientists to find alternatives to animal testing (like computer models), reduce the number of animals used when possible, and refine methods so that any discomfort is minimized.
If you’re wondering why we should care about all this? Well! The impact of animal research can be significant! These studies contribute greatly to fields like medicine and conservation. For instance, understanding how certain species communicate helps us protect endangered animals by preserving their habitats or breeding programs.
